Large eddy simulation of gravity currents: a finite element
analysis
Brian Baitis
This paper is a compilation of my undergraduate research
for the 2004 & 2005 school year. The motivation behind this project
was to first understand what gravity currents were and why we study
them. We did this by running a numerical model and tested several
parameters to see their effects on the solution of the gravity
currents. Then, I wrote a finite element code for the less complex
convection-diffusion problem to help my understanding of the Navier
Stokes Equations. Since convection diffusion is a linear model of
the Navier-Stokes equations, the two can be related.
